874 Meadowsweet Cir, Sun Prairie, Wi 53590 is where Steven lives. This person has lived also in Madison, Fitchburg and North Fond Du Lac. Possible relatives of Steven are: Debra S Jacquart, Linda J Gilles, Larry I Rupert and one other person. 1966 is his birth date. Steven has reached 59 years of age. Records link phone number (608) 825-1071 with Steven’s details.